Join us for a unique matinée experience, brought to you by KINOTEKA, designed especially for families and young viewers. Experience some of the most memorable Polish, French and British short animated features at Ciné Lumière, complemented by live music from celebrated jazz artists from Wrocław. The melodies will convey various narratives, mixing cinematic stories with spontaneous musical journeys, thereby immersing youngsters into the world of jazz.

The line-up includes:

Autumn with Reksio
Directed by Jan Ćwiertnica, Poland, 1979, 9 mins

Witness Reksio’s cleverness as he prepares for the impending winter.

Bolek and Lolek: Beachside Adventure
Directed by R. Lepiora, Poland, 1978, 8 mins

Follow the seaside vacation of Bolek, Lolek, and Tola as they each set out on a separate journey due to a disagreement on travel means.

COLARGOL (Restored Version)
Directed by Albert Barillé, France/Poland, 1970, based on a creation by Olga Pouchine.

See Colargol venture to school, struggling with math and discovering his vocal abilities!

Foo Foo: The Uninvited Guest
United Kingdom, 1960, 6 mins

Enjoy the comic tale of a man’s ingenious attempt at sneaking onto a ship.

The musical accompaniment will be provided by the Kuba Lechki/Łukasz Ciesiołkiewicz Duo: Kuba Lechki (drums, electronics) and Łukasz Ciesiołkiewicz (vibraphone, electronics)

Post-screening, children can interact with the musicians and explore their instruments.
